Toronto - Toronto Pearson International Airport (TPIA) is located 27 km (16 miles) north/west of downtown Toronto and within the Greater Toronto Area (GTA) which includes the regions of Durham, York, Halton, Peel and Toronto. The airport - covering 1,792 hectares (4,430 acres) - has been Toronto's main international airport since 1939 when it was first known as Malton Airport.

There are many ways to travel to and from Pearson Airport - by car, public transit, inter-city buses or taxis and limousines.
